Cass Gilbert: a pioneer of American architecture
Cass Gilbert, renowned architect, marked the early 20th century with his bold achievements and unique style. Trained at the École des Beaux-Arts, he was influenced by the neo-Gothic movement and European traditions, integrating these elements into his American works. Gilbert is especially known for his iconic buildings, such as the Woolworth Building in New York, which demonstrate his ability to combine functionality and aesthetics. The Utrecht Cathedral Tower not only showcases his talent but also his interest in historic structures, emphasizing the importance of preserving architectural heritage.
